Inicialmente nossas reuniões terão 3 horas de duração. Dentro dessas 3 horas, a codificação será feita obedecendo as seguintes regras:
- Deve haver uma sala, com apenas um computador ligado a um projetor;
- A codificação será feita em duplas (piloto e co-piloto);
- Todo o código produzido deve ser explicado para os espectadores no momento de sua confecção;
- Todos devem estar entendendo perfeitamente o código que está sendo produzido. Caso contrário, a codificação pára para que o piloto e co-piloto expliquem o que está sendo feito. A codificação só é retomada quando todos estiverem entendendo o código;
- Os espectadores só podem dar sugestões de design (padrões, construções, estratégias de codificação, …) quando todos os testes estiverem passando. Caso contrário, poderão apenas tirar dúvidas;
- O piloto é trocado a cada 5 minutos de codificação. O co-piloto assume o posto e um expectador como co-piloto. Esse processo é repetido até o final da reunião;
- Todo o código produzido é publicado no site. Caso o desafio não seja completado, será retomado na próxima reunião.
Agosto 11, 2007 às 12:27 am
Gostaria de estar participando dessas reuniões, porém moro em outro estado. Caso a reunião fosse as 13h, por exemplo possibilitaria a mim e outros amigos interessados participar destas reuniões. Obrigado.